What Is the Cost of Living Near Bloomington?

Understanding the cost of living near Bloomington is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Monroe County Election Board.
Bloomington's Cost of Living Index is approximately 92.7 (7.3% less expensive than US average; 2.3% more than IN average). Home to Indiana University, housing costs higher due to university.
